Activity itinerary

Zlatni Rat Beach (Golden Horn)
  • 1h 30m
Our tour starts with a panoramic 50-minute cruise to our first stop, The Golden Horn beach on Brac island. It is one of the most famous beaches on the Adriatic. Golden Horn is a beautiful pebble beach protruding almost half a kilometre into the turquoise sea in a V-shape. What makes this beach unique is its shape which visibly changes depending on the direction of the wind and tidal movement. Here you will have plenty of free time to swim, snorkel and sunbathe. Your skipper will drop you off at a small pier on the beach and meet you there when it is time to head to your next stop. "Remaining time will be allotted to panoramic cruise."
Hvar Island
  • 45m
Our next stop is Zečevo islet, only 10-15 minutes away from Golden Horn. Zečevo is an unpopulated islet in the archipelago of Hvar and it is protected as a significant landscape. It prides itself on untouched nature and crystal-clear turquoise seas. It is a perfect spot for snorkelling. There is also a beach bar that you can visit if you want to wind down a bit.
Vrboska
  • 2h
After enjoying beach fun on Zečevo, we head to Vrboska village on Hvar island. Vrboska is a small tranquil village situated along a narrow fjord-like bay. Since the bay goes through the middle of the village, numerous bridges connect its two sides. Because of that fact, Vrboska is nicknamed "Little Venice." We usually recommend our guests a spot for lunch. After lunch, you can wander through Vrboska's small charming streets and enjoy the calmness of the village.
Jelsa
  • 45m
After lunch, we head to Jelsa town, where you have some free time for a coffee or do a bit of sightseeing. Jelsa is an ancient town on Hvar island with numerous historical monuments that speak about its rich history.
Mala Stiniva
  • 30m
Our last stop is in Mala Stiniva bay on Hvar island. Mala Stiniva is a picturesque stone bay with cliffs that vertically drop to the sea below. It is a stunning sight and a place that leaves no one indifferent. The sea is crystal-clear, and the cliffs are a great cliff jumping spot.
Makarska
  • 40m
After Mala Stiniva, we head back to Makarska harbour. A panoramic cruise during which you can wind down as you take in the spectacular views of the islands and scenic Makarska Riviera coastline is a perfect way to end our day.
